Stock Context
RELX reaffirmed its 2026 outlook after saying the year started well across all four divisions. The company expects another year of strong underlying growth in revenue. As part of a £2.25 billion buyback programme announced in February 2026, RELX completed a £350 million non-discretionary buyback on 22 April 2026, with another £350 million tranche planned between 23 April and 22 May 2026. In Risk, momentum was driven by financial crime compliance, digital fraud and identity products, insurance solutions and strong new sales, with underlying growth expected and profit rising faster than revenue. Full first-half results are scheduled for 23 July 2026.
